How does one become an IKEA franchisee?

• thorough retail experience • extensive local market knowledge and presence • corporate culture and values • financial strength and ability to carry through the investment penetrating a country in full and in a large-scale retail environment format Any franchisee must demonstrate its ability to establish and operate IKEA stores nationally.

Can I invest in IKEA?

You’re probably thinking of investing in IKEA, your favorite furniture store. Unfortunately, the IKEA stocks are not yet available in the Stock Exchange because the furniture giant is a privately held company. This means that the entire IKEA shares are firmly locked.

Is IKEA owned by one person?

Put it shortly, IKEA as a brand comprises two separate owners. INGKA Holding B.V. owns the IKEA Group, the holding the group. At the same time that is held by the Stichting INGKA Foundation, which is the owner of the whole Group.

Who owns the IKEA stores?

The IKEA brand is owned and managed by Inter IKEA Systems B.V., based in the Netherlands, owned by Inter IKEA Holding B.V. Inter IKEA Holding is also in charge of design, manufacturing and supply of IKEA products.

How much does it cost to own an IKEA?

To open an IKEA franchise, large ownership groups invest significant capital — upwards of $100 million for each location — and agree to manage all of the stores in a specific country.

Does IKEA own all its stores?

Today all IKEA stores (except the IKEA Delft in the Netherlands) operate under franchise agreements. Inter IKEA Systems B.V. is the owner of the IKEA Concept and worldwide IKEA franchisor.

What kind of franchise is IKEA?

IKEA is a franchise business. That means that many groups of companies work together under one IKEA brand. Franchising is a system that encourages everyone to contribute and collaborate. The franchisor is responsible to continuously develop the IKEA Concept and ensure its implementation in new and existing markets.

How many shareholders does IKEA have?

IKEA is not owned by shareholders. Instead, it is controlled through a number of operating companies, holding companies, and nonprofit foundations. The complex corporate structure was created partly in response to high Swedish taxation.

How much freedom do you have as a franchisee?

"Inter IKEA Systems B.V. owns the IKEA Concept. As a franchisee, we can sell the IKEA Product Range, use the IKEA trademarks and operate according to proven working methods, following the IKEA values. Within this framework, we have the freedom to make certain decisions about what to sell and when.

IKEA's franchising system

Inter IKEA Systems B.V. is the owner of the IKEA Concept and worldwide IKEA franchisor, and they have assigned other IKEA companies to develop range, supply and communication. Together with IKEA franchisees, we improve and develop IKEA to be more relevant and inspiring.

IKEA Group becomes Ingka Group

We are moving from operating as IKEA Group to operating as Ingka Group. We do this because we run a number of businesses adjacent to IKEA Retail that aren’t technically part of the IKEA Concept, and want to clarify who we are as a company in relation to the IKEA franchise system.

Who owns IKEA?

Inter IKEA Systems B.V. is the owner and world-wide franchisor of the IKEA Concept and aims to bring IKEA products to as many people as possible by franchising the IKEA Concept to franchisees. Right to franchise the IKEA Concept is only granted in new countries with no IKEA operations present. All our existing IKEA Stores are shown at our homepage.

What is Ikea concept?

The IKEA Concept. The IKEA Concept is based on offering a wide range of well designed, functional home furnishing products at prices so low that as many people as possible will be able to afford them. Rather than selling expensive home furnishings that only a few can buy, the IKEA Concept makes it possible to serve the many by providing low-priced ...

How many companies own Ikea?

IKEA stores are operated by 11 companies under franchise agreements with Inter IKEA Systems B.V.. Inter IKEA Systems B.V. also owns and operates a single store — the IKEA Delft store in the Netherlands.

Who owns IKEA in Taiwan?

The IKEA franchise in Taiwan was initially owned by Jardine Matheson, but it is currently owned by Dairy Farm International Holdings. On April 26, 2021 the first IKEA store to open in Taiwan (located on the corner of Tunhua North Road and Nanjing East road in Taipei) closed down after 23 years of service.

Where did Ikea start?

IKEA began in southern Sweden when founder Ingvar Kamprad developed his entrepreneurial skills during childhood and began selling matches via his bicycle. He discovered that he could purchase matches cheaply in bulk then re- sell at an extremely low price while still recovering a decent profit.
